An exciting opportunity to buy one of the most iconic plots on Sandbanks. Positioned at the very top of Evening Hill this substantial home is almost a gatehouse to Sandbanks Peninsula. In an elevated position it is set back from the road, private and protected behind a gated driveway. The views are phenomenal from the ground and first floors, a unique site that is perfect for refurbishment or redevelopment. The house is approached by a paved driveway and there is a detached double garage and plenty of parking and turning space. The property is traditional in style with large rooms, high ceilings and picture windows to appreciate the views. The front door brings you through to an impressive dining hall with sweeping staircase up to the second floor. The kitchen opens into a large conservatory extension enjoying beautiful views across the water. A formal dining room with feature fireplace also looks out over the harbour and a separate reception to the side of the home makes an ideal home office or snug. A large and useful utility room connecting to the rear garden completes the ground floor. Upstairs was originally four bedrooms but is now two large ensuite bedrooms and also a palatial principal suite with balcony overlooking the harbour. Outside the rear garden is tiered with walkways and patio viewpoints placed to best appreciate the outlook. There is a real opportunity here to create a fantastic modern family home or even for development potential STPP.
